| | Title: On the Bondage of the Will Author: Luther, Martin Publisher: CCEL Description: Luther's part of the debate between him and Erasmus over the issue of free will and predestination. Luther maintained that sin incapacitates human beings from working out their own salvation, that they are completely unable to bring themselves to God. In this treatise, he begins by examining Erasmus's argument. He then discusses the power and complete sovereignty of God Subject: Theology|Salvation Type: Book Pages: 230 Filesize:
